My lab have just received a new Waters Acquity Premier UPLC for the front end of a Sciex 5500 MS. We use Analyst 1.7.1 software for data acquisition.

Everything is communicating fine and I can control the system via the Waters Console. However, I am unsure on three things:

1) Do I need to create a hardware profile that includes the Waters UPLC, and if so how do I do this?

2) How do I create acquisition methods? I've tried using the Acquity Method Editor and managed to save these on top of a Sciex acquisition method file. However, when I open the acquisition methods, only the MS parameters are displayed. When I open the LC method again in the Acquity editor, all the changes I made previously have disappeared.

3) How do I set an injection volume? This is normally within the LC settings and the Sciex batch file will pull it through from the companion software (this is how it works when using an Agilent LC). Or is it necessary to manually set the injection volume in the batch?

Thankfully I figured everything out and it all works smoothly. Acquity UPLC systems are fully compatible with Analyst software (and Sciex OS I believe). For anyone else in this situation, this is how you do it:

Firstly, you need to install the relevant Waters device drivers (info here: https://support.waters.com/KB_Inst/Chro ... ex_Analyst). For reference, I am using Analyst 1.7.1 with HotFix 1, and I used the Waters device drivers 2022 (release 1).

You should see "ACQUITY Console" and "ACQUITY Method Editor" appear in your Analyst companion software list in the bottom left.

Secondly, set up communications with your Acquity modules (follow this guide: https://support.waters.com/KB_Inst/Chro ... t_software).

Open the ACQUITY console from within Analyst to configure your UPLC modules. If you have a Sample Organizer, this may not show up straight away. You have to configure this manually in the console.

Next, create a hardware profile in Analyst with your mass spec, then add the UPLC via Add device > Software application > Software application (not configured) > ACQUITY UPLC.

To make methods, activate your hardware profile and create a method as normal within Analyst. Put in your MS method settings then save the method. Next, open the ACQUITY method editor and open the .dam file you just saved. Input your LC settings here then click File > Save method as, and save over the .dam file. That should be it. To input injection volume, do this in the batch editor within Analyst.
